Sql query writing software

You can write and execute sql statements in access, but you have to use a backdoor method to do it. Our company rang the dinner bell for sql queries a while back and the whole company showed up. Solarwinds database performance analyzer free trial. There are many sql management tools available in the market, and therefore it is challenging to select the best tool for your sql project management. Created by quest, toad for sql server is a popular sql software that aims to increase productivity for the development and management of databases. Solved user friendly software for pulling sql reports sql. Sql is incredibly powerful, and like every wellmade development tool, it has a few commands which its vital for a good developer to know. Sql is a standard language for storing, manipulating and retrieving data in databases. Schema panel use this panel to setup your database problem create table, insert, and whatever other statements you need to prepare a representative sample of your real database. You can use the where clause with the update query to update the selected rows, otherwise all the rows would be affected. Before we start talking about them, it is good to know that these 10 queries work on all types of sql engines available in the market. Create a query that selects all rows and columns from the excel file.

Sql query tool using odbc is a universal data access uda tool. How do i get the query builder to output its raw sql query as a. Our sql query tool is a wellpolished unit for creating database queries on a whole new interactivity level thanks to the visual features via graphical sql query designer when dealing with sql server through a neat and intuitive ui. Youll want to doublecheck this syntax with your product team because it may differ based on the software you use to pull your sql queries. Its also safe to let more experienced users write sql queries by hand. Introduction to sql learn how to write database queries. Since in reallife projects sql queries are hardly oneliners, learning the right way to write a sql query makes a lot of difference when you read it yourself later or you share that query to.

Our sql query tool is a wellpolished unit for creating database queries on a whole new interactivity level thanks to the visual features via graphical sql query designer when dealing with sql. You can also connect and query sql server, an azure sql database, and azure sql data warehouses using azure data studio. In general fortunately, you dont need to understand any arcane technical language to write sql queries that work. Sql server query writing strategies is something i have yet to find in any book.

The best way to get acquainted with ssms is through handson practice. Your queries will be saved along with the database connection right beside the database object tree, so youll be able to continue your work from the point where you stopped last time. Eversql validator is a free online syntax checker for mysql sql statements. Querybuilders like the one included in sql developer can assist an unexperienced user, but they are dumb and usually produce less than optimal sql. In order to allow full sql optimization, you should be more explicit when writing sql queries and specify column aliases when a situation with duplicate column names arises. Best tool for assisting writing complex sql queries. Mysql, sql server, ms access, oracle, sybase, informix, postgres, and other database systems.

Visual sql query builder for desktop apps and web sites to get data from sql. What i would like is a piece of software to unveil the preliminary datasets from which a result is built, to. If you work for a software company and want to pull usage data on your customers, you. Sql developer, database designer, data science, or.

Razorsql sql query tool and sql editor for mac, windows, and. If you plan to write infrequent or only short sql queries, all the free tools would do the work. Active query builder is a fullfeatured suite for programmers to deal with sql queries and make database schema clear for endusers. Is there a site for online sql practice, besides sqltest. Available as an addin for sql server management studio and visual studio, sql prompt pro strips away the repetition of coding. Includes a robust relational database hsqldb that is up and running with no. It lets you query odbc data sources, author sql scripts and queries, execute multiple sql scripts or stored procedures simultaneously, return query results to a grid or freeform text, export results in excel and html formats. How to write a sql query to generate a report stack overflow. A detailed list of 20 best sql query builders handpicked by experts.

The tutorial below provides an introduction to the syntax for sql querying against excel files, focusing on common approaches when pulling data from excel as a querysurge source or target. It comes with a customizable ui that is equipped with robust tools for facilitating database interaction. Sccm configmgr sql query to check software update is. Every query that you run uses sql behind the scenes. The best sql query optimization tools and software 1. So,i sat for sometime in the lab,started writing the sql query,found something. What we need to have is userfriendly software that would be able to integrate with our current sql database and allow for users to navigate through tablescolumns dropdown. Structured query language sql is an indispensable skill in the data science industry and generally speaking, learning this skill is relatively straightforward. Visual sql is purely built on sql, which means you save time getting the program to. Free source code and tutorials for software developers and architects updated. Viewing queries in this format makes it much easier to understand the effect of sql statements. Youll build a strong foundation in sql and databases, this will then allow you to start building sql queries and perform more complex reporting on a database. Eversql will automatically optimize mysql, mariadb, perconadb queries and suggest the optimal indexes to boost your query and database performance.

Anyone looking to learn sql and gain practice reading and writing queries within a relational database or pursuing a career as a. Razorsql query, edit, browse, and manage databases. Sql query builder dbforge query builder for sql server is an sql query builder to make your sql queries fast and simple regardless of their complexity. Perform more complex queries by learning essential query keywords and functionality. The sql update query is used to modify the existing records in a table. The history of sql query execution is saved automatically. The first word of each query is its name, which is an action word.

Sometimes it comes down to trialling different types of queries to get one that gives you the results you want and has good performance. Often times, when a dba or database programmer, are not available in companies, then it is up to you to get your hands. Toad is expensive but have 4 productivity features. Razorsql sql query tool and sql editor for mac, windows. So, rather than joining table a to temporary view b, you can join table a to the query that you have been using as temporary view b. The basic syntax of the update query with a where clause is as follows. If every software company would provide only as half as your speed and. If you are looking for a proper tool to work with data and sql queries with an adhoc visual query builder, youve got to a look at flyspeed sql query. Here are the best sql editors available today in the market. Many of us have used and worked with databases one way or another. The first time you run ssms, the connect to server window opens. Using flyspeed sql query, you can build parameterized queries, and browse data from linked tables via foreign keys.

Im a professional sql writer and work with professional sql colleges. The ignition sql bridge module brings the power of structured query language sql databases to your industrial process. I have always been a huge fan of redgates software, and i can confidently say that sql prompt is a masterpiece. When enthusiastic sql students do this, they experience a revelation. Create select, insert, update, and delete sql statements. You can create a new query or copy a query from an existing configuration manager report, paste the sql statement into the sql pane of the query designer, and easily add views, create joins. This method is easy if you want to check for specific software update but,what if you want to have a list of software updates that are superseded by what software updates. Structured query language is a standard computer language that is used to communicate with databases. Using query designer to write report sql statements. However, without the right sql query optimization tool, tuning can be tricky. Structured query language is a domainspecific language used in programming and designed for managing data held in a relational database management system rdbms, or for stream processing in a. Perform more complex queries by learning essential query. Sql select statement is the most commonly used command.

Solved user friendly software for pulling sql reports. On khan academy, we store data about users and badges and progress. Research has proven that these 10 queries are only 3% of entire query set which can be formulated in sql. The free version provides a fullfeatured workplace for working with sql queries and browsing the result data. If you dont have access to a sql server instance, select your platform from the following links. Razorsql is an sql query tool, database browser, sql editor, and database administration tool for windows, macos, mac os x, linux, and solaris. Query builders like the one included in sql developer can assist an unexperienced user, but they are dumb and usually produce less than optimal sql. Learn sql a language used to communicate with databases using sql and learn how to write sql queries. Moreover, debugging and writing sql statements can be done much faster, thanks to. Query builder for sql server is a visual designer tool for convenient generation of. It lets you query odbc data sources, author sql scripts and queries, execute multiple sql scripts or stored procedures. A bit of a shot in the dark here, but if you are writing lots of temporary views perhaps you havent realized yet that most places you could put a table in an sql statement, that table can be replaced by a query. Free sql query tool with a powerful visual query builder. The query will prevent subsequent sql optimization, since this select statement would result in a dataset with two columns called id.

This course is designed to familiarize participants with basic sql statements. Each of the queries in our sql tutorial is consequential to almost every system that interacts with an sql database. However, most forget that sql isnt just about writing queries, which is just the first step down the road. There are a range of best practices or tips that are recommended for working with sql. You can use sql prompt to rename all occurrences of a variable or alias in a query. Active query builder is a component for software developers to let users build sql. Begin writing a sql query to pull your desired data. The module allows you to leverage ignitions unlimited tags and database connections at an astonishingly low price even if you dont know much about sql databases. If you choose sql authentication, use your sql server login credentials. Now that you have mastered how to create a sql query, lets walk through some other tricks that you can use to take it up a notch, starting with the asterisk.

For those complex query requirements, this tool saves the anguish that can be experienced in writing fully qualified sql when you make the smallest of errors or. Jan 26, 2016 greetings, im having some trouble narrowing down the software i would need for pulling datareports from a sql database. When you add an asterisk to one of your sql queries, it tells the query that you want to include all the columns of data in your results. Eversql is an online sql query optimizer for developers and database administrators.

Our sql basics tutorial teaches you writing and using that sql select statement is used to. Writing efficient and highquality sql is hard to do. Use mri and sql to create a select query to view data. I think every sql product has an ide with a text editor and some helper utilities as syntax completion. There is a lot of detail provided on each tool below, but if you only have time to glance at a list, here is our list of the best sql software and query optimization tools.

Sql syntax check online, sql validator, instant sql. Understanding how sql works can help you create better queries, and can make it easier for you to understand how to fix a query that is not returning the results that you want. Connect to and query a sql server instance sql server. In configmgr, software update information is scattered across multiple tablesviews and depends on your requirement,you must choose right table to query the information. Sql is a computer language that closely resembles english, but that database programs understand. Best tool for assisting writing complex sqlqueries. What i would like is a piece of software to unveil the preliminary datasets from which a result is built, to make it easier to see where values gets wrongly duplicated, filtered etc. Writing solid sql queries that perform efficiently is a routine task that relies on finelycalibrated tuning. The tool that executes the query is not important, it will only make it easier to view and export the results. Sql select query the sql select statement is used to fetch the data from a database table which returns this data in the form of a result table.

To open a basic editor where you can enter sql code, follow these steps. Im super wary of even more than 5 nonit employees writing sql queries and custom reports. Advanced sql queries, examples of queries in sql list of. Sql query tool using odbc free download and software. To be simple, a database client basic functionality consist in. In this introduction to sql, we will give a quick overview of the types of some of its everyday commands and uses. Sql query builder tool to design and edit queries visually devart.

Razorsql is an sql query tool, database browser, sql editor, and database administration tool for windows, macos, mac os x, linux, and solaris razorsql has been tested on over 40 databases, can connect to databases via either jdbc or odbc, and includes support for the following databases. Not online but consider using which is a selfcontained, serverless, zeroconfiguration, transactional sql database engine. Sync schemas, deploy from version control, write sql, and more with our mega. Technical sql queries i live training mri software. Writing and formatting sql code by hand, even with intellisense, is frankly pretty dull. How would i write the sql query to generate this report based on the above table structure. The validator will compile and validate sql queries to report for syntax errors. You can verify if your table has been created successfully by looking at the message displayed by the sql server, otherwise. If on the other hand you need to write dozens of queries a day, with some of them queries expanding over a single screen of code, than my recommended tool is toad.

Writing sql statements in the query designer component of the microsoft sql server management studio provides a graphical interface for writing queries. Weve got people writing little vb and vba apps that query the db and never close the connection and. But these 3% cover 90% of regular operations on database. In order to allow full sql optimization, you should be more explicit when writing sql queries and specify column aliases when. Active query builder is a component for software developers to let users build sql queries visually and get data from sql databases fast and safe. Advanced sql queries, examples of queries in sql list of top.

Sql query builder tool to design and edit queries visually. Aug 18, 2016 how to write basic sql statements in sql server. Microsoft excel handles sql via its own sql dialect. This windows app connects to all modern database servers and works with all popular desktop databases and office file.

359 1292 122 662 1630 928 202 761 856 1219 1518 1264 175 1577 580 130 586 1022 636 199 931 1123 341 932 1412 1047 558 1203 395 1070 1347 1138 109 1496 1231 747 31 188 789 353